What originally gave Popeye his strength?

Fictional character and story
Originally, Popeye got “luck” from rubbing the head of the Whiffle Hen; by 1932, he was instead getting “strength” from eating spinach. Swee’Pea is Popeye’s ward in the comic strips, but he is often depicted as belonging to Olive Oyl in cartoons.

Was Popeye created to sell spinach?

Surprising as it may seem, it is not, and the character was not created by the spinach industry. It was not created either to help sell spinach. In fact, the tinned sustenance was chosen a little by chance, perhaps because it is a source of vitamins and iron.

Are Brutus and Bluto the same?

After the theatrical Popeye cartoon series ceased production in 1957, Bluto’s name was changed to Brutus because it was incorrectly believed that Paramount Pictures, distributors of the Fleischer Studios cartoons, owned the rights to the name “Bluto”.

Is Popeye Sweet Pea father?

In the comics, Swee’Pea debuted on July 24, 1933 strip as a foundling infant left on Popeye’s doorstep. Popeye adopts and raises him as his son, or, as he puts it, “boy-kid”.

What nationality is Popeye?

The character of Popeye was created by Elzie Crisler Segar, an American cartoonist from the town of Chester, Illinois. In 1919, the draughtsman created a comic strip in New York’s Evening Journal, called Thimble Theatre.

Did Bluto ever eat spinach?

In some cartoons it was directly shown that, unlike Popeye, Bluto hates spinach, which is the primary reason he will not use it against Popeye. However, in Twisker Pitcher Bluto eats spinach to win a baseball game against Popeye.

Why does Popeye have pipes?

In the animated cartoons, Popeye uses it to make sounds that imitate a ship’s horn, often as punctuation when singing his theme song, and/or to blow puffs or smoke. He also employs his pipe in various useful ways, either as a blowtorch, to propel himself into the air, or even to suck spinach into his mouth.
